When the Fire Burns Low

When the fire burns low and the embers flare out 
the cold and lonliness will creep in
And the sorrow will begin
The emptiness will find you there shivering
The saddness will watch you withering
when the fire burns low and the embers flare out 
You will be there alone without that special someone
And the tears will come
Utter saddness shall find your heart
Your soul and spirit shall slip apart 
So when the fire burns low and the embers flare out
I will be there
But only because I care
